21879-81-2,21880-31-9,21880-64-8,2188-13-8,296274-15-2,29627-61-0 Supplier | KPCKS.IN
CMO CDMO service. KPCKS.IN supply 21879-81-2,21880-31-9,21880-64-8,2188-13-8,296274-15-2,29627-61-0 and related compounds.
2188-13-8 21880-64-8 296274-15-2 29627-61-0 21879-81-2 21880-31-9